Satura rādītājs:

Servo stūres robotu automašīna Arduino: 6 soļi (ar attēliem)
Servo stūres robotu automašīna Arduino: 6 soļi (ar attēliem)

Video: Servo stūres robotu automašīna Arduino: 6 soļi (ar attēliem)

Video: Servo stūres robotu automašīna Arduino: 6 soļi (ar attēliem)
Video: izmantojot HJ Digital Servo motoru un ESC testera motorus bez sukām [ar subtitriem] 2024, Jūlijs
Anonim
Image
Image
Servo stūres robotu automašīna Arduino
Servo stūres robotu automašīna Arduino
Servo stūres robotu automašīna Arduino
Servo stūres robotu automašīna Arduino

Šīs automašīnas pamatā ir arduino platformas dizains, kodols ir Atmega - 328 p, kas spēj realizēt priekšējo riteņu stūrēšanu, aizmugurējo riteņu piedziņu un citas funkcijas.

Ja spēlējat vienatnē, jāizmanto tikai bezvadu modulis; Ja vēlaties ieviest citas funkcijas, iespējams, būs jāpievieno citi sensori vai aparatūra.

1. darbība. Nepieciešamās detaļas

Nepieciešamās detaļas
Nepieciešamās detaļas
Nepieciešamās detaļas
Nepieciešamās detaļas
Nepieciešamās detaļas
Nepieciešamās detaļas

Ja vēlaties, lai automašīnu vadītu ar stūres mehānismu , Nepieciešamas šādas detaļas :

  • Arduino, arduino saderīga versija (zils putns)
  • Motora vadītāja panelis: PM-R3
  • Barošanas akumulators: 7.4V -18650
  • Tālvadības daļa : PS2 (protams, varat izmantot arī Bluetooth vadību)
  • Dupont līnija: neliels daudzums
  • Protams, jums būs nepieciešams arī automašīnas rāmis (ieskaitot motoru, servo)

PM - R3 modulī integrēta I/O paplašināšana un motora piedziņa

  1. Divkārša motora izeja
  2. Jaudas ievade
  3. Digitālā I/O (S V G)
  4. Analogais I/O

2. darbība: rāmja (piedziņas daļas) uzstādīšana

Uzstādiet rāmi (piedziņas daļu)
Uzstādiet rāmi (piedziņas daļu)
Uzstādiet rāmi (piedziņas daļu)
Uzstādiet rāmi (piedziņas daļu)

Vispirms mēs uzstādām piedziņas daļu, piedziņas motors ir JGA25-370, izmantojot pārnesumu samazināšanas piedziņas asi un riteņa uz priekšu atkāpšanos, motora vārpstas pārnesums ir liels, jo pēc piedziņas vārpstas un atbalsta attāluma ir mazs, nevar uzstādīt lielu pārnesumu, bet kopumā joprojām lēns.

Aizmugurējo riteņu gultņi ar atloku gultņiem, lai novērstu pārnesumu slīdēšanu uz leju braukšanas laikā, varat arī samazināt enerģijas patēriņu.

  • motora kronšteins x1
  • 370 ātrgaitas motors x 1
  • Gear A pāris
  • 5 mm vārpsta x 1
  • Atloku gultnis x 2
  • 5 mm sakabe x 2
  • M3 * 8 mm skrūve un uzgrieznis x 5

3. darbība: priekšējās stūres daļas

Priekšējās stūres daļas
Priekšējās stūres daļas
Priekšējās stūres daļas
Priekšējās stūres daļas

Pirms pagrieziena daļas tiek pieņemts RC dizains, arī ar lielāko daļu piederumu, piemēram, riteņu daļas; Lai saglabātu elastīgus riteņus gan gultņa iekšpusē, gan ārpusē ar uzstādīšanu. MG996R metāls kā stūres pastiprinātājs, stūres mehānisms ar diviem L formas kronšteiniem jābūt piestiprinātiem pie šasijas, Servo motora savienojošais stienis, uzstādot, lūdzu, pārliecinieties, ka stūres leņķis jau pieder (1,5 ms), pārslēdzieties uz ērtās regulēšanas jomu un vēlu.

  • M2,5 * 12 mm skrūve un uzgrieznis x 1
  • M3 * 8 mm skrūve un uzgrieznis x 4
  • M4 bloķēšanas uzgrieznis x 2

4. solis:

Attēls
Attēls
Attēls
Attēls
Attēls
Attēls

Tiks samontēts daļās, un servomotors ir piestiprināts pie zāliena, Nevar pievilkt skrūvi, kas piestiprināta pie krūzes, tas novedīs pie pagriešanās, iespējams, izdeg servomotors un vienas mikroshēmas mikrodators; Izmantojot savienojumu stienis savieno divus priekšējos riteņus un ir savienots ar stūres leņķa servomotoru; Servo motors ir piestiprināts ar M3 * 8 mm skrūvi un uzgriezni, piestiprināts ar M2,5 * 8 mm skrūvi pie krūzes, vara kolonnas puse ir 2 M3 * 8 mm skrūve.

  • M2,5 * 8 mm x 5
  • M2,5 * 20 mm x 1
  • M3 * 8 mm x 10
  • M3 uzgrieznis x 4
  • Vara statnis x 4

5. darbība: savienojuma daļa

Savienojuma daļa
Savienojuma daļa
Savienojuma daļa
Savienojuma daļa
Savienojuma daļa
Savienojuma daļa
Savienojuma daļa
Savienojuma daļa

Ar motoru darbināmu pagarinātāju var izmantot tieši, un mātesplatē bez citas elektroinstalācijas, tikai saņemot PS2 uztvērēju un servomotoru, saņemot I/O porta paplašināšanas paneli, VCC un GND paplašināšanas plates barošanas ievades portu, motora izeju A + un A -, cita motora izeja B+ un B-. Tātad, mēs varam kontrolēt abus līdzstrāvas motorus, šeit mums ir nepieciešams tikai viens interfeiss.

Servo tapa: I/O 4

PS2 izveidoja pārsūtīšanas paneli, ērtu elektroinstalāciju, aizsardzību pret atgriezenisko savienojumu, iesakiet šādu savienojumu šeit

PS2 tapa:

  • GND: GND
  • VCC: +3.3v vai +5v
  • DAT: A0
  • CMD: A1
  • CS: A2
  • CLK: A3

Ieejas jauda VIN & GND, 3-9 V sprieguma diapazons.

6. darbība: kods

Pārveidojot programmu, lai sasniegtu robota staigāšanu, motora vadību uz priekšu un atpakaļ, servo vadības virzienu; Programma satur PS2 vadību, Bluetooth vadību un sekošanas līniju.

Programma jāmaina uz jaunāko versiju, lai tā atbilstu jaunajam PM-R3.

Veco kodu skatīt PS2_old

Ieteicams: